WebMar 26, 2024 · Looting, broadly speaking, is the act of illegally taking an artifact from an archaeological site. This can be as simple as taking an arrowhead off the ground while hiking to deliberately digging and removing objects from sites to sell or keep. WebWhat does Looted mean on TikTok? The term ‘looted’ was popularised by TikToker user @chasinn.loot. The word is a synonym for “drip” and “swag”, used to describe someone’s outfit or style. A lot of @chasinn.loot’s videos also use the snippet of YoungBoy Never Broke Again’s ‘I Don't Know’.
